Output d5c1d238ee2ad7d9faf85bc372e56a89dd6cd799e98eba63e3bbffcddffdb98e:0

value
1372843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0bd842c784158a4de04497b87c3a6ae598ea0d1 OP_EQUAL
address
3NBLKLXDm14wk1iUwGY6K8mdxWimUpP7qT
transaction
d5c1d238ee2ad7d9faf85bc372e56a89dd6cd799e98eba63e3bbffcddffdb98e
confirmations
331548
spent
true